559 Fights makes Fresno debut June 13







CLOVIS, Calif. – 559 Fights will make its much-anticipated debut in Fresno on Thursday, June 13 at Club Eva. 

“This is something that’s been talked about for a long, long time. It was never our plan to move into the Fresno market, but we were presented with a great offer from Club Eva to come work out there,” said 559 Fights President Jeremy Luchau. “Things really fell into place and ultimately I felt it was a good decision for 559 Fights, it’s fans and more importantly the fighters.”

Doors open at 6 p.m. with mixed martial arts action kicking off at 7. Tickets start at just $30 and are available at Visalia’s MMA Gear, Core Sports Nutrition and www.559fights.com

Featured in the main event is 559 Fights’ first-ever title fight, pitting Firebaugh bantamweight Matt Perez (4-0) vs. Exeter’s Alex Valencia  (3-1).

“It’s something special to fight for our promotion’s first title fight. There were several fighters worthy of this honor, but I’m not sure we could have put together a better fight than Perez vs. Valencia,” Luchau said. “This is going to be a great fight for the fans and for all involved.”

In the co-main event, Fresno welterweight Art Hernandez (5-2) takes on Madera’s Chris Huerta and in another featured bout Fresno featherweight James Spear (2-5-1) battles Merced’s Andrew Garza (0-0-1).

“Hernandez and Huerta will be a fun fight. Both of these guys are veterans of the amateur circuit and well on their way to competing at the professional level soon,” Luchau said. “Spear is one of the more exciting fighters in the Valley and I think it will be a lot of fun to watch him fight at home in front of the Fresno crowd.”

559 Fights has produced 14 MMA shows from Bakersfield up highway 99 into Tulare, Visalia, Hanford and Lemoore. It is currently one of the more respected amateur promotions in the state and was host to the 2012 CAMO Regional State Finals.

559 Fights returns to action at the Kings Fair on Friday July 5 and then heads back to Visalia’s Recreation Ballpark on August 24.

“We really don’t have a home base. We’ve moved all over, starting in Hanford, going into Tulare, Bakersfield, Lemoore, Visalia and now Fresno. We have plans on reaching out into some other smaller communities and continue to spread our reach and help promote MMA and these fighters throughout the Central Valley,” Luchau said.

Arreola meets Hickox in 559 Fights return to Tulare County Fair

HANFORD, Ca. – The Tulare County Fair will play host to the next addition of 559 Fights on Saturday, September 15.

Lemoore’s Alberto Arreola puts his unbeaten record of 3-0 on the line against Exeter’s Dakota Hickox (1-0) in a lightweight headliner at the Tulare Fair.

Tickets start at $25 and include fair admission. Tickets can be purchased at the Tulare County Fair office, Visalia’s MMA Gear in the Sequoia Mall in Visalia and at www.559fights.com.

“ We are very excited to be returning to Tulare. We had a great event in July and we are looking for a great crowd with some action-packed fights at this year’s fair,” said 559 Fights President Jeremy Luchau.

“Currently we have 16 scheduled fights, which includes 12 athletes from Tulare County. Also on the card are three bouts in the junior division, which features contestants under the age of 18 in bouts with modified MMA rules, including protective gear.”

In the co-main event, Tulare’s Ruben Rojas (1-0) from locally run Kings Knights take on Madera’s Matt Perez (2-0). Kings Knights also feature two competitors in the junior division, as Joseph Madrid makes his debut against Hanford’s Freddy Esquivel and Valentino Esparza makes his debut against Madera’s Angel Berrazza.

In the other youth bout, Clovis’ Porter Sharp meets Visalia’s Daniel Sauceda.

Competitors under the age of 18 wear protective head gear, shin guards for certain age groups and compete with modified rules such as no head strikes, elbow strikes and only a select few submission holds are allowed.

“We had a great response from our last event in Hanford featuring some of the youth and junior competitors and the folks in Tulare really wanted to bring some of those bouts out there,” Luchau said. “Plus we have some other pretty interesting local bouts, featuring fighters from local gyms.”

Visalia featherweight Cameron Ramirez (2-1) makes his return to action against Bakersfield’s David Mendoza (1-0) and Tulare’s Armando Espinoza makes his highly anticipated lightweight debut against Merced’s Edward Mackey (0-0).
